Brierley comes to Business Objects with a strong track record of strategic selling into the enterprise, particularly in the Business Intelligence industry, as well as many years experience in the Middle East market. Most recently Brierley served as Regional Manager Middle East, Greece and Turkey for Cognos. In this role Brierley was responsible for the Middle East office and the success of the entire region, both through direct operations and the Channel. Before Cognos, Brierley worked in Sales Management for companies including Mediasurface Plc, Intershop Communications Inc and Trustco Plc.

In recent years Business Objects has established a strong presence in the Middle East and signed up several new customers including Aramco, Saudi Telecom Company, International Foodstuffs Company, Standard Chartered Bank, Commercial Bank of Dubai, RAK Bank, DU, YUM!, Kingdom Hotel Investments, Qatar Foundation, Jordan Telecom, Dubai Healthcare City and National Bank of Dubai. In addition to global partnerships handled locally with IBM and NCR, Business Objects has developed an effective network of local partners and resellers including Al Bilad Arabia, Al Mazroui & Partners, Emitac, Exhortech Business Solutions, Imtac, Intercom, KASP, Master Mind Technology, Mindware, Softflow and Tech Access.
